Across TCGA patient cohorts, RNA activity of the Mesenchymal cell apoptotic process pathway is significantly associated with the protein abundance of multiple proteins, with the BRCA cohort showing a particularly strong set of associations.

The most reproducible pathway-associated proteins across cancer lineages are PPFIBP1, CEBPD_S191, and PLEC, each associated with the pathway in up to 6 cancer types. Since the analysis shows associations rather than directional relationships, both pathway-to-partner and partner-to-pathway views are reported.
